2024-01-08 20:19:10 +08:00
|
|
|
# ps
|
|
|
|
|
|
|
|
> 提供正在运行的进程的信息。
|
2024-01-10 09:51:22 +01:00
|
|
|
> 更多信息:<https://manned.org/ps>.
|
2024-01-08 20:19:10 +08:00
|
|
|
|
|
|
|
- 列出所有正在运行的进程:
|
|
|
|
|
|
|
|
`ps aux`
|
|
|
|
|
|
|
|
- 列出所有正在运行的进程,包括完整的命令字符串:
|
|
|
|
|
|
|
|
`ps auxww`
|
|
|
|
|
|
|
|
- 查找与字符串匹配的进程:
|
|
|
|
|
|
|
|
`ps aux | grep {{字符串}}`
|
|
|
|
|
|
|
|
- 以 extra full 格式列出当前用户的所有进程:
|
|
|
|
|
2025-03-19 00:36:34 +02:00
|
|
|
`ps {{[-u|--user]}} $(id {{[-u|--user]}}) -F`
|
2024-01-08 20:19:10 +08:00
|
|
|
|
|
|
|
- 以树形方式列出当前用户的所有进程:
|
|
|
|
|
2025-03-19 00:36:34 +02:00
|
|
|
`ps {{[-u|--user]}} $(id {{[-u|--user]}}) f`
|
2024-01-08 20:19:10 +08:00
|
|
|
|
|
|
|
- 获取一个进程的父进程 ID:
|
|
|
|
|
2025-03-19 00:36:34 +02:00
|
|
|
`ps {{[-o|--format]}} ppid= {{[-p|--pid]}} {{进程 ID}}`
|
2024-01-08 20:19:10 +08:00
|
|
|
|
|
|
|
- 按内存使用量对进程进行排序:
|
|
|
|
|
2025-03-19 00:36:34 +02:00
|
|
|
`ps {{[k|--sort]}} size`
|